Name        : python-neovim
Product     : Fedora 41
Version     : 0.5.2
Release     : 2.fc41
URL         : https://github.com/neovim/pynvim
Summary     : Python client to Neovim
Description :
Implements support for python plugins in Nvim. Also works as a library for
connecting to and scripting Nvim processes through its msgpack-rpc API.

ChangeLog:

* Fri Jan  3 2025 Andreas Schneider <asn@xxxxxxxxxxxxxx> - 0.5.2-2
- Fix asyncio with Python 3.14
- resolves: rhbz#2326224
* Fri Jan  3 2025 Andreas Schneider <asn@xxxxxxxxxxxxxx> - 0.5.2-1
- Update to version 0.5.2
* Wed Jul 24 2024 Miroslav Suchý <msuchy@xxxxxxxxxx> - 0.5.0-8
- convert ASL 2.0 license to SPDX
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
References:

  [ 1 ] Bug #2326224 - python-neovim fails to build with Python 3.14: AttributeError: module 'asyncio' has no attribute 'get_child_watcher'
        https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=2326224
